Is Sleeping on the Floor Good for your Back?
It is important to note that there is no scientific evidence on sleeping on the floor benefits. However, there is an opinion that floor sleeping helps to straighten the spine, relieve muscle tension and eliminate back pain.
This argument seems to hold the most weight when it comes to comparing sleeping on the floor to sleeping on a soft mattress. Obviously, if your mattress is too soft, your spine is more prone to curvature, which is likely to lead to back pain.

Sleeping on the Floor can Cause Allergies
If you are prone to allergies, sleeping on the floor might not be the best idea. The floor tends to accumulate huge amounts of dust, mites, skin cells, and other elements that can cause allergies.
Those who sleep on the floor on a regular basis often experience the following symptoms:
difficulty breathing or coughing
watery eyes, constant itching
various skin rashes
runny nose and persistent sneezing
If you like the idea of sleeping on the floor, you can't do without constant wet cleaning, dusting, and vacuuming. You should also consider getting an air filter that prevents mold, various allergens and fungus.

Who is not Recommended to Sleep on the Floor?
There are many positive reviews about sleeping on the floor and its benefits. However, there are also contraindications for this method of sleeping for a certain group of people:
New mothers or pregnant women: There is some debate about whether it is a good idea to sleep on the floor while pregnant. However, when pregnant, getting up from the floor can also be uncomfortable even if you just put your mattress on floor.
Older people: As we get older, our immune system weakens and our bones become more fragile. People who are older have a greater risk of getting sick while sleeping on the floor, and it can be very uncomfortable for them.
People with limited mobility: These people may have difficulty getting down to the floor and then back up. Additional difficulties may occur immediately upon awakening even if they put a mattress for sleeping on the floor.
People with circulatory problems: It is always colder to sleep on the floor. This kind of sleeping can be detrimental to people who have circulatory problems, especially those who have been diagnosed with anemia or diabetes.

Sleeping on your Back
If you like to sleep on your back, then sleeping on the floor is good for you. This position aligns your spine and the large surface area allows your weight to be distributed evenly.

What about those who are Side Sleepers?
About 75% of people prefer to sleep on their side. Sleeping on the floor is not recommended for them. This is because a hard floor can contribute to fixing your spine in an uncomfortable position, and as a result, you will wake up with painful symptoms.
